👥 What are Customers?
Customers are the individuals or businesses you provide services to and invoice. The Customer Management section helps you:
- Store customer contact information
- Track customer transaction history
- Organize customers for easy access
- Generate customer-specific reports

🔍 Searching for Customers
Use the search functionality to quickly find a customer:
- Click in the Search box
- Type customer name, email, or phone number
- Results filter automatically as you type
Example searches:
John- Find all customers named John@gmail.com- Find all Gmail customers+91- Find all customers with Indian phone numbers

Delete Customer
- Find the customer in the list
- Click the Delete button (trash icon)
- Confirm the deletion
Delete Warning
Deleting a customer will not delete their associated invoices, but you won't be able to create new invoices for them.

📤 Importing Customers
If you have existing customer data:
- Prepare a CSV file with customer information
- Go to Settings → Import/Export
- Choose Import Customers
- Upload your CSV file
- Map the columns to match the required fields
- Click Import
CSV Format Example:
Name,Email,Phone,Address,City,State,Pincode
John Doe,john@example.com,+91-98765-43210,"123 Main St",Mumbai,Maharashtra,400001
Jane Smith,jane@example.com,+91-98765-43211,"456 Park Ave",Delhi,Delhi,110001
